BEYOND TEXAS
Ann DeFee

Reviewed by Sandra Wurman
Posted January 1, 2014

Romance

How can you combine a possible kidnapping crime solving mystery with a laugh out loud southern comedy replete with the oddest and yet endearing characters I've yet to meet? Well ask Ann DeFee since that's exactly what she accomplished in BEYOND TEXAS.

The people of Mirage Texas are very unique, as unique as the town of under 3000 people and as with small towns they face economic challenges. Twinkie and her mother have their hands in a multitude of business endeavors and even so these ladies somehow still have the time and ability to get involved with many town issues. Right now it looks like Mirage could be facing a doozy of a problem.

It would appear that someone has recently purchased an old fort on the outskirts of their town and suspicions are abounding as to what possibly nefarious purposes that fort property is going to be used.

So far it's looking very suspicious but they first have to gather information. Who better to come to the aid of Mirage than two hunks who are in town for a seemingly innocent reason of their own. But Twinkie and her merry band of friends and family are nobody's fools. The ladies of The Ranch are a rather raunchy group of an ex-madam and her ladies of the evening. These same ladies are the adopted family of none other than Twinkie and are an intrinsic part of this ongoing investigation into the activities of the inhabitants of the fort. Age has definitely not slowed down these ladies and they are all fearless.

When faced with the indisputable evidence that there are young women in trouble this town and its never-ending supply of industrious people kick into action and that's when the fun really starts.

Of course there is a subplot of romance and or lust included in what is already a story of boundless energy and fun. I would be remiss to leave out the yummy attraction between Twinkie and Cole. Cole is one of the two hunks that appear in Mirage with an interesting but false reason for coming to this very small town. The real reason is that Cole suspects that his sister has been kidnapped, has somehow wound up in Mirage and her disappearance may be involved with the new owner of the fort.

Ah what an interesting web of lies and deceit are soon to be uncovered by this very eclectic band of investigators. Well done. Ann DeFee has once again treated us to a truly enjoyable feast for the mind. If you are already a fan then BEYOND TEXAS should be on your next read list. If you are not already a fan then this book should be included on your must read. Be ready to laugh out loud and at the same time intrigued by this creatively written mystery/romance/comedy.

SUMMARY

There's no place like Texas. And there's no one like a Texan!

Twinkie Sue Carmichael and her mother own the Clown Motel in Mirage, Texas, known for its mysterious desert lights. She's also the mayor. Like everyone else in these parts, Twinkie's worried about the goings-on at nearby Fort Huacha, an abandoned military facility, which has been taken over by a group of men calling themselves the Brothers.

When Cole Thornton comes to Mirageโ€”with his own questions about the Brothersโ€”Twinkie's hormones go on high alert. So does her internal alarm. Is this great-looking guy really what he seems? Cole and Twinkie fall in love (or certainly lust!), surrounded by an eccentric cast of characters, from her cohort of girlfriends to her sheriff ex-husband. From Cole's high-powered family to his former partner. Not to mention his missing sister, a group of young pregnant women and a houseful of retired hookers.

But as the Brothers and assorted other bad guys learn, you don't mess with Texans!
